How far is Cayman Brac from Havana?

The distance between Havana (José Martí International Airport) and Cayman Brac (Charles Kirkconnell International Airport) is 280 miles / 450 kilometers / 243 nautical miles.

Distance from Havana to Cayman Brac

There are several ways to calculate the distance from Havana to Cayman Brac. Here are two standard methods:

Vincenty's formula (applied above)
  • 279.500 miles
  • 449.812 kilometers
  • 242.879 nautical miles

Vincenty's formula calculates the distance between latitude/longitude points on the earth's surface using an ellipsoidal model of the planet.

Haversine formula
  • 280.143 miles
  • 450.846 kilometers
  • 243.437 nautical miles

The haversine formula calculates the distance between latitude/longitude points assuming a spherical earth (great-circle distance – the shortest distance between two points).

How long does it take to fly from Havana to Cayman Brac?

The estimated flight time from José Martí International Airport to Charles Kirkconnell International Airport is 1 hour and 1 minutes.

Flight carbon footprint between José Martí International Airport (HAV) and Charles Kirkconnell International Airport (CYB)

On average, flying from Havana to Cayman Brac generates about 66 kg of CO2 per passenger, and 66 kilograms equals 146 pounds (lbs). The figures are estimates and include only the CO2 generated by burning jet fuel.
